I was moving the alternator higher to put more tension on the belts. I was using a pry bar to do so, and it slipped and I saw a spark. I'm pretty sure it touched one of the wires going to the CAS(some of the actual wire was exposed) while also touching the block. I then go and try to start the car and nothing happens. None of the lights in the idiot cluster come on and the sunroof doesn't work either. But the dash lights, headlights and taillights, and the windows still work. So obviously something got shorted out but I don't know what. If anyone has any advice please let me know. And this is on a '86 N/A.
